PICKLED SWEET CORN RAINBOW RELISH



Pickled Sweet Corn Rainbow Relish image

Provided by Jeff Mauro, host of Sandwich King

Categories     condiment

Time 1h15m

Yield 3 cups

Number Of Ingredients 8

3 ears corn, kernels cut from the cob
1 red bell pepper, diced
1 orange bell pepper, diced
1 jalapeño, diced (seeds and ribs removed if desired)
1/2 small red onion, diced
3/4 cup white wine vinegar
1 tablespoon kosher salt
1 tablespoon sugar

Steps:

  • Put corn, red and orange bell peppers, jalapeño and red onion in a large bowl. Bring vinegar, salt, sugar and 1/4 cup water to a boil and immediately pour over relish. Let cool in the fridge for at least 1 hour or up to overnight. Will stay good for up to 1 month.

COCOHON'S PICKLED PEACHES



Cocohon's Pickled Peaches image

A spicy pickled peach which can be canned in either quarts or pints. The recipe reminded me of my grandma's - her peaches were always gloriously spicy with some heat from field peppers & ginger to add depth. These serve as the base for Recipe#368601 . Found in The Times-Picayune. Made 3 quarts - tasted the syrup (had plenty left over) & made 1/2 the syrup again & pickled 3 more quarts! Used 3 fresh Kung Pao peppers (with slices in them) per quart. My, oh my, these are tasty now but will be the best come Thanksgiving!

Provided by Busters friend

Categories     Fruit

Time 1h20m

Yield 3 quarts

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 sticks cinnamon
2 tablespoons cloves, whole, crushed
3 tablespoons black peppercorns
1 bird chile, whole dried (1 teaspoon chile flakes)
2 tablespoons ginger, grated fresh
6 cups sugar
1 quart white vinegar
8 lbs peaches, peeled, halved (small to medium )

Steps:

  • Tie spices in a cheesecloth bag. Combine sugar, vinegar, and spice bag in a large sauce pot; boil 5 minutes.
  • Cook peaches in this boiling syrup until they can be pierced with a fork, but are not soft. Remove from heat and allow peaches to sit in pickling liquid overnight to plump. The next day, bring mixture back to a boil. Remove spice bag.
  • Pack peaches into hot sterilized jars, leaving ¼-inch head space. Ladle hot liquid over peaches, leaving ¼-inch head space. Remove air bubbles.
  • Adjust two-piece caps. Process 20 minutes in a boiling-water bath.

SWEET PICKLE RELISH



Sweet Pickle Relish image

This chunky relish is great for eating fresh or going into the pantry in the middle of winter cracking open a jar and putting on your hotdogs! Also great to add to macaroni salad!

Provided by cindymartin21502

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Relish Recipes

Time 2h35m

Yield 96

Number Of Ingredients 10

8 cucumbers, chopped
2 onions, chopped
1 red bell pepper, chopped
1 green bell pepper, chopped
½ cup pickling salt
cold water to cover
2 cups cider vinegar
1 tablespoon celery seed
1 tablespoon mustard seed
3 ½ cups white sugar

Steps:

  • Combine cucumbers, onions, red bell pepper, and green bell pepper in a large bowl; add salt and pour in enough cold water to cover. Allow to soak for 2 hours. Thoroughly drain in a colander.
  • Pour vinegar into a large, heavy stainless steel pot; add celery seed and mustard seed. Stir sugar into mixture and bring to a boil, stirring until sugar is dissolved, 2 to 3 minutes. Add the drained vegetable mixture and return to a boil, about 10 minutes. Remove pot from heat.
  • Sterilize the jars and lids in boiling water for at least 5 minutes. Pack relish into hot, sterilized jars, filling to within 1/4 inch of the top. Run a clean knife or thin spatula around the insides of the jars after they have been filled to remove any air bubbles. Wipe the rims of the jars with a moist paper towel to remove any food residue. Top with lids and screw on rings.
  • Place a rack in the bottom of a large stockpot and fill halfway with water. Bring to a boil and lower jars into the boiling water using a holder. Leave a 2-inch space between the jars. Pour in more boiling water if necessary to bring the water level to at least 1 inch above the tops of the jars. Bring the water to a rolling boil, cover the pot, and process for 10 minutes.
  • Remove the jars from the stockpot and place onto a cloth-covered or wood surface, several inches apart, until cool. Press the top of each lid with a finger, ensuring that the seal is tight (lid does not move up or down at all). Store in a cool, dark area.

GREEN TOMATO AND PEACH RELISH



Green Tomato and Peach Relish image

Make and share this Green Tomato and Peach Relish recipe from Food.com.

Provided by ratherbeswimmin

Categories     Fruit

Time 1h8m

Yield 2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 11

1/2 large vidalia onion, cut into thick slices
2 large firm green tomatoes
1 lime
1 firm peach, peeled, pitted, and cut into 1/4-inch dice (not too ripe peach)
1 jalapeno pepper, roasted, peeled, seeded, and diced
2 scallions, cut into 1/4-inch slices
fresh ginger, peeled and grated (2-inch piece)
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
kosher salt
fresh ground black pepper
finely chopped chives (or fresh parsley or fresh basil, or fresh cilantro)

Steps:

  • Prepare a hot grill or preheat the broiler.
  • Grill or broil the onion slices for 3-4 minutes per side, until blackened and charred.
  • Cut the tomatoes into wedges and remove the pulp and seeds, leaving the tomato flesh.
  • Cut the flesh into 1/2-inch dice and place in a small bowl.
  • Grate the zest from 1/2 the lime, then halve the lime.
  • Add the peaches to the tomatoes, along with the lime zest and juice of 1/2 lime.
  • Add the jalapeno, grilled onion, scallions, and ginger ; toss to mix.
  • Add the olive oil and salt and pepper.
  • Adjust the seasonings as necessary--more lime juice may be needed.
  • Add the fresh herb if desired.

SWEET AND TANGY PEACH RELISH



Sweet and Tangy Peach Relish image

Provided by Elizabeth Green

Categories     Sauce     Fruit     Onion     Side     Vegetarian     Peach     Summer     Simmer     Gourmet     Fat Free     Vegan     Pescatarian     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es about 2 1/2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 medium peaches, about 1 1/2 pounds, peeled and cut into 1/2-inch-wide slices
3/4 cup sugar
1/2 cup cider vinegar
1/4 teaspoon hot red-pepper flakes
1 small red onion, halved lengthwise and sliced crosswise 1/8 inch thick (1 cup)
3/4 te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• Combine peaches, sugar, vinegar, and hot pepper flakes, and briskly simmer, uncovered, until liquid thickens slightly, 15 to 20 minutes. Stir in onion and salt and simmer for 5 minutes. Relish will continue to thicken as it cools.
